Description

Positioned along the peaceful stretch of Papercourt Lane on the rural edge of Ripley, Brendon is a chalet-style home shaped by changing needs and everyday living, where light-filled spaces and adaptable rooms create a home that evolves as life does. A private driveway to the front adds to the sense of ease and arrival.

Step inside Brendon and the feeling is immediately relaxed and welcoming. Downstairs is all about choice and adaptability. To the rear, the living room draws you in, with double doors opening directly onto the garden and green views that soften the space throughout the day. It connects naturally with the adjacent kitchen, where the peninsula island becomes the natural gathering point - a place for morning coffee, casual meals, homework conversations or a glass of wine while dinner comes together. The layout encourages connection, with an easy, sociable flow that suits both everyday living and relaxed entertaining.

Towards the front, a generous double bedroom sits complete with fitted storage, while an adjacent reception room is currently styled as a study - though it has easily functioned as a snug, hobby space and dining room in the past. It’s this quiet versatility that defines Brendon, rooms shift effortlessly as life evolves.

Throughout Brendon there’s a confident nod to style. Pops of colour and thoughtful interior touches give the spaces personality without overwhelming them - curated yet comfortable, expressive yet calm.

Upstairs, the mood subtly shifts to something more restful. Brendon continues to unfold thoughtfully, with a dormer loft conversion creating two well-proportioned double bedrooms sitting beneath Velux windows that flood the space with natural light. The principal bedroom feels like a true retreat, complete with an en-suite shower room and elevated views stretching towards the canal. The second bedroom offers its own quiet charm, with cleverly concealed storage tucked neatly away, alongside a fresh, well-presented family bathroom. Storage throughout the house has been thoughtfully considered, keeping day-to-day life uncluttered and effortless.

Step outside and the garden continues Brendon’s easy, adaptable feel. Designed to be simple to maintain, it offers the freedom to enjoy outdoor living without the upkeep. A pergola-covered seating area at the far end creates a sheltered spot to unwind, while the patio closest to the house is ideal for easy summer evenings, with the added benefit of convenient side access.

Whether it’s quiet evenings on the sofa, focused mornings working from home, or a lively kitchen filled with friends and family, Brendon supports a variety of lifestyles with an ease that’s increasingly hard to find.

Then there’s Ripley itself - a village that quietly steals hearts. From the village green and independent High Street to the monthly farmers’ market, Papercourt Sailing Lake and the River Wey Navigation, life here is shaped by community, countryside and tradition. Walks past Newark Priory and paddle boarders drifting beneath Ripley Bridge add to the gentle rhythm of life by the canal.

Brendon is not just a home, but an opportunity to shape a way of living - one that balances calm and connection, character and comfort. Perfectly placed for countryside lovers yet moments from village life, Papercourt Lane offers space to grow, adapt and settle into something enduringly special, with convenient access to the A3 and M25 placing wider connections easily within reach.
